Probable component, possibly from weaponry. A cast copper alloy angular bar with two attachment holes and several rebates. Several faces are decorated with engraved patterns of zig-zag bands and hatching. What appears to be the main face along a narrow edge, is decorated with a blackletter inscription (of unknown meaning) with hatching between the letters. (The inscription probably reads E preue--:) The function of this object is uncertain, but it is well made and decorated suggesting it is from an item of some value and importance.
